Under the daily direction of the Preparedness Operations Supervisor and the supervision of the Preparedness Program Manager, performs complex (journey-level) public health emergency preparedness/emergency management program coordination for ESF-8 public health emergency preparedness and response activities. Primary work duties involve evaluating the planning, development, review and revision of of local/county ESF-8 public health and medical plans, including pandemic response. Work includes writing, research, meeting facilitation, presenting, training, evaluating, and maintaining close collaboration with local, state, and federal emergency management and public health officials. Provides technical assistance to public health staff, emergency management staff, governmental agencies, community organizations, or the public on ESF-8 functions. Serves as a member of the Region 8 Incident Management structure during emergency response and recovery operations. Assists with supporting ESF-8 needs at local emergency operations centers (EOCs), Disaster District Emergency Operations Center (DDEOCs) or Regional Health and Medical Operations Center (RHMOC) during planned and unplanned events. This participation may require a change in shift, location and/or supervisor. Works under general supervision, with moderate latitude for the use of initiative and independent judgment. Must be able to independently travel within the State of Texas and out-of-state to complete essential job functions as needed.
